Humus (or humous) is the organic matter in the soil. It is made of dead parts of plants and animals. Humus takes in water and has plenty of nutrients. Nitrogen is the most important. Plants put roots into the soil to get the water and nutrients. Humus is good for plants because it is like a sponge. The dark color of humus (usually black or dark brown) helps to warm up cold soils in the spring.

Abu al-Fazal ibn Mubarak (Persian: ابو الفضل‎) also known as Abu'l-Fazl, Abu'l Fadl and Abu'l-Fadl 'Allami (14 January 1551 – 12 August 1602) was the Grand vizier of the Mughal emperor Akbar, and author of the Akbarnama, the official history of Akbar's reign in three volumes, (the third volume is known as the Ain-i-Akbari) and a Persian translation of the Bible.[1] He was also one of the Nine Jewels (Hindi: Navaratnas) of Akbar's royal court and the brother of Faizi, the poet laureate of emperor Akbar.

The sun was born about 4.6 billion years ago. Many scientists think the sun and the rest of the solar system formed from a giant, rotating cloud of gas and dust known as the solar nebula. As the nebula collapsed because of its gravity, it spun faster and flattened into a disk. Most of the material was pulled toward the center to form the sun. The sun has enough nuclear fuel to stay much as it is now for another 5 billion years. After that, it will swell to become a red giant. Eventually, it will shed its outer layers, and the remaining core will collapse to become a white dwarf. Slowly, this will fade, to enter its final phase as a dim, cool theoretical object sometimes known as a black dwarf.

Glutathione (GSH) is an antioxidant in plants, animals, fungi, and some bacteria and archaea. Glutathione is capable of preventing damage to important cellular components caused by reactive oxygen species such as free radicals, peroxides, lipid peroxides, and heavy metals.[2] It is a tripeptide with a gamma peptide linkage between the carboxyl group of the glutamate side chain and cysteine. The carboxyl group of the cysteine residue is attached by normal peptide linkage to glycine.

Chloroplasts /ˈklɔːrəˌplæsts, -plɑːsts/[1][2] are organelles that conduct photosynthesis, where the photosynthetic pigment chlorophyll captures the energy from sunlight, converts it, and stores it in the energy-storage molecules ATP and NADPH while freeing oxygen from water in plant and algal cells. They then use the ATP and NADPH to make organic molecules from carbon dioxide in a process known as the Calvin cycle. Chloroplasts carry out a number of other functions, including fatty acid synthesis, much amino acid synthesis, and the immune response in plants. -------------------------------------------------------------chloroplast is a type of organelle known as a plastid, characterized by its two membranes and a high concentration of chlorophyll. Other plastid types, such as the leucoplast and the chromoplast, contain little chlorophyll and do not carry out photosynthesis.

Various methods of asexual reproduction are:

i. Binary Fission - Fission in which the parent cell divides to form two similar daughter cells. Example - Amoeba.

ii. Multiple Fission - Fission in which the parent cell divides to produce more than two daughter cells. Example - Plasmodium.

iii. Budding - The reproductive method in which an organism produces an outgrowth on its body surface, which then matures and develops into a new individual. Example - Hydra.

iv. Spore Formation - Spore formation is an asexual mode of reproduction found in certain multicellular organisms like <i>Rhizopus.</i> The thick walled spores have the capacity to develop into new individuals under suitable conditions.

The female silk moth lays hundreds of eggs on the mulberry leaves. The larvae that hatch out of the eggs are called silk worms or caterpillars. The caterpillars feed on mulberry leaves vigorously. When the silkworms are ready to enter the next stage of its development called pupa it stops feeding and its salivary glands secretes a fibre around the pupa to hold itself. The fibre is made up of protein called fibroin which hardens on exposure to air. Then it swings its head from side to side in the form of figure of eight forming a cover around pupa. This covering is known as cocoon. The further development of the pupa into moth continues inside the cocoon. The most common silk moth is the mulberry silk moth.

A median of a triangle is a line segment joining a vertex to the midpoint of the opposite side. A triangle therefore has three medians.
